WebCut the stems: Before you put those roses in water, trim 1-2 inches off the end of each steam. Garden shears are best for this task, but kitchen scissors or a sharp, clean knife will also do. Cut at an angle to help the stems take in water more easily since they aren't resting flat against the bottom of the vase. Web11 sep. 2024 · Keep your roses away from direct sunlight and heat. Similar to produce, keeping cut flowers cool helps preserve them after they’ve been picked. Generally speaking, the cooler the environment, the better your cut roses will fare.
